Subject: [PATCH] phy: qcom: uniphy-28lp: add COMMON_CLK dependency

In configurations without CONFIG_COMMON_CLK, the driver fails to build:

aarch64-linux-ld: drivers/phy/qualcomm/phy-qcom-uniphy-pcie-28lp.o: in function `qcom_uniphy_pcie_probe':
phy-qcom-uniphy-pcie-28lp.c:(.text+0x200): undefined reference to `__clk_hw_register_fixed_rate'
aarch64-linux-ld: phy-qcom-uniphy-pcie-28lp.c:(.text+0x238): undefined reference to `of_clk_hw_simple_get'
phy-qcom-uniphy-pcie-28lp.c:(.text+0x238): dangerous relocation: unsupported relocation
aarch64-linux-ld: phy-qcom-uniphy-pcie-28lp.c:(.text+0x240): undefined reference to `of_clk_hw_simple_get'
aarch64-linux-ld: phy-qcom-uniphy-pcie-28lp.c:(.text+0x248): undefined reference to `devm_of_clk_add_hw_provider'

Add that as a Kconfig dependencies.

Fixes: 74badb8b0b14 ("phy: qcom: Introduce PCIe UNIPHY 28LP driver")
Signed-off-by: Arnd Bergmann <arnd@arndb.de>
---
 drivers/phy/qualcomm/Kconfig | 1 +
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/drivers/phy/qualcomm/Kconfig b/drivers/phy/qualcomm/Kconfig
index a6b71fda1b9c..c1e0a11ddd76 100644
--- a/drivers/phy/qualcomm/Kconfig
+++ b/drivers/phy/qualcomm/Kconfig
@@ -157,6 +157,7 @@ config PHY_QCOM_M31_USB
 config PHY_QCOM_UNIPHY_PCIE_28LP
 	bool "PCIE UNIPHY 28LP PHY driver"
 	depends on ARCH_QCOM
+	depends on COMMON_CLK
 	depends on HAS_IOMEM
 	depends on OF
 	select GENERIC_PHY
